Project Overview

On January 23, 2009, the Ministry of Energy announced that Invenergy was awarded the bid to build, own and operate a 52 turbine, 78 MW wind project.

It will be located on 9300 acres of private land in the former townships of Raleigh and Tilbury East in the Municipality of Chatham-Kent. When completed, it is estimated that the Wind Farm will generate over 200,000 MW Hours of renewable energy per year. 

 

Timeline and Status

Invenergy has completed field studies, wind assessments and design work.

Construction began in October 2009 and will take approximately 8-12 months.

Benefits of the Raleigh Wind Energy Centre

  • Once operational the wind farm will require approximately 8 full time operation and maintenance staff and some secondary staff.

  • During the construction phase the labor force is expected to peak at approximately 150 people. Based on previous projects, over half of this labor will be hired locally.

  • Local construction contracts are anticipated to have a value between $25 to $35 million.

  • Property taxes are expected to add $150,000-$250,000 annually to municipal coffers while placing a minimal demand on municipal services.

  • Option and lease payments to landowners during the 20-year term of the Ontario Power Authority (OPA) contract are forecasted to be more than $15 million..

About Us

 

Founded in 2001, Invenergy LLC is a leading clean energy company focused on the development, ownership, operation and management of large-scale electricity generation assets in North America and Europe. Invenergy’s home office is located in Chicago. It has regional development offices in Austin; Denver; Minneapolis; Portland; San Diego; San Francisco; Washington D.C.; Toronto, Canada; Aberdeen, Scotland; and Warsaw, Poland.

 

To date, Invenergy has:

·         Completed development/construction of 18 wind energy facilities, with approximately 2,000 megawatts (MW) of aggregate generating capacity;

·        Completed development/construction of five natural gas-fueled power facilities, with approximately 2,200 MW of aggregate generating capacity;

·        Initiated additional renewable and clean power projects (wind, natural gas and solar) that will be placed in service staring in 2009, capable of generating in aggregate close to 20,000 MW;

·         Created hundreds of new development, construction and operations jobs; and

 

Actively supported the formation of national and global renewable and clean energy policies.
